About

Mill Bridge 200 Metres South-West Of The Abbey is a Grade II listed building-listed bridge in england-west-midlands, United Kingdom, registered on the National Heritage List for England (NHLE entry 1096010). Heritage listing

Details STONELEIGH 1827/0/10028 Mill Bridge c200 metres south-west of 26-NOV-02 the Abbey II Bridge and sluices. Bridge dated 1704, with C19 sluices and alterations. Ashlar and wood, with iron fittings. 2 round arches with cascades, divided by a central stepped buttress on the downstream side. Splayed balustrade walls with rounded coping. On the upstream side, 4 sluices, the gates now missing. Legacy The contents of this record have been generated from a legacy data system. Legacy System number: 489900 Legacy System: LBS
